Step 1 – Finding Your Spot. Once you find an open space, let people know your intentions. Put on your turn signal to let people behind you know that you’re planning to parallel park. Pull up next to the open space and make sure your car can actually fit in the spot.

This video will give you full explanat...When the right end of your front bumper is lined up with the rear bumper of the car ahead of your space, steer left as far as your wheel will turn. Look behind you and back up until your vehicle is parallel with the curb. Move forward while you straighten your wheels. On average, at least in the United States, the width of a road with parallel parking spaces should measure at least 35 feet (10.7 meters) wide. Straighten out, and voila! It’s often easier said than done, though. Best practice when you parallel park is to leave 12-18 inches from the curb and about 12 inches between the two other vehicles.
